The percentage of the adult population in 70.3% Cyprus who is now fully vaccinated against coronavirus, while 76.6% have received the first dose.
As announced by the Ministry of Health of Cyprus, giving to the public data regarding the course of vaccinations until Saturday, August 14, 2021, the corresponding rate of full vaccination coverage in the EU is 62.4%. In terms of the percentage of people who received at least the first dose and is at 76.6%, the goal is to reach 80% by the end of August. Respectively, in the EU the percentage is 73%.
In terms of ages 16 to 17, the full vaccination as broadcast by the Athens News Agency amounts to 22.3%, while 32% have received the first installment.
